BHS, Inc., a leading manufacturer of custom material handling equipment based in St. Louis, MO, has announced the launch of a new line of modular attachments for order picker trucks. These solutions are designed to optimize picking tasks through interchangeable components, addressing the increasing reliance on order picker trucks in modern warehouses.
The new product line includes four series: Modular Order Picker Carts, Modular Order Picker Platforms, Order Picker Furniture Carts, and Order Picker Furniture Platforms. The carts are equipped with heavy-duty casters, enabling them to serve as pushcarts for ground-level inventory management, while the platforms omit casters to function solely as attachments. The furniture-specific variants are sized to fit the longer forks of furniture order picker trucks.
According to Trent Boothe, Technical Sales Manager at BHS, the goal is to make order picker trucks safer, more productive, and adaptable to various tasks. "With the growth in narrow-aisle racking, more warehouses are relying on order picker trucks," Boothe said. "Our goal is to make those trucks safer, more productive, and flexible enough to handle anything."
A key feature of these attachments is their custom sizing, which eliminates gaps or offsets between the platform and the truck's operator deck. This design reduces tripping hazards, a common safety risk associated with order picker truck attachments. The modularity allows users to adjust shelf spacing, remove shelves, or add rails and guarding to create an ideal work platform. All components are bolt-on and can be easily modified with standard tools.
The modular design provides the benefits of custom equipment without extended lead times. "We specialize in designing custom equipment, but it takes time to design something from scratch," Boothe explained. "Our modular solutions ship a lot faster than an all-original product. They give you custom performance without custom lead times."
